Output 23f14425eed3181490d1de125a851e6e35349d27568884f4c08099a251523ef4:4

value
40455956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42527c82dd47f4ee99c493e5c7265d843cce3476 OP_EQUAL
address
MDwqeLwSZeoMo9qy8Xn4E4AMsAc5XiStg4
transaction
23f14425eed3181490d1de125a851e6e35349d27568884f4c08099a251523ef4
spent
true